A group of employees of the Ceylon Electricity Board (CEB) staged a protest opposite the Head Office today demanding that action be taken against the "electricity mafia" that had assistance from some CEB members.
The protestors also called on authorities to take action against CEB officials who they said were responsible for the recent island-wide blackout.
